# Onboarding: Order Cutoff Service

Crumbwharf Bakery enforces a 14:00 order cutoff via the CutoffGate service. Rule changes deploy only through the signed pipeline; manual edits to the cutoff table are blocked. Review scope: confirm deploys are signed and logged. No exceptions for holiday schedules without a signed release. Verify pipeline artifacts against the deploy key below.

deploy key for kajof-yawif: bky9_fvxrpdHPq

Subject: Recording studio bookings — Mellow Wing

Dear team assistants,

The training-video studio on level 2 of the Mellow Wing is now bookable through the Roomfinder calendar under "Studio M2". Please reserve in 90-minute blocks and allow 15 minutes for setup, as the lighting rig needs to warm up. The sound-proof door locks automatically, so anyone escorting presenters must carry the pass below. Use the following code at the keypad:

badge for hahip-bagag: bdg-FIJ-9

Handover note — formula sandbox (for plugin authors)

Continuing Odile's work on the Greymarsh sandbox: plugin-supplied formulas now run in an isolated interpreter with capped memory and no filesystem access. Please validate your plugins against the new limits before the next release window. If the sandbox lockfile becomes corrupted, restore it using the recovery passphrase immediately below.

vault phrase of bagaf-kajeg = jorath-feniel-briir-siliel-ralix